The Good

  • High RTP Rates: Many online Keno games offer an RTP (Return to Player) of around 90% to 98%, meaning the potential for returns is relatively good compared to other casino games.
  • Flexible Betting Options: Players can choose to bet on a varying number of spots (from 1 to 20), offering a wide range of betting styles and risk levels.
  • Simple Gameplay: Keno’s rules are easy to understand, making it accessible for beginners, which encourages players to try different strategies without feeling overwhelmed.

The Bad

  • Low Odds of Winning Big: While the RTP is high, the actual odds of hitting the maximum payout can be very low, especially when playing for 15-20 numbers. For instance, hitting all 20 numbers can have odds of about 1 in 3.5 quintillion.
  • Limited Strategy Impact: Unlike games like poker, Keno is primarily a game of chance. Most strategies, such as number selection or betting patterns, do not significantly affect the outcome.
  • Potential for Over-Expenditure: The fast-paced nature of Keno can lead to rapid betting, and players may find themselves spending more than intended if not careful.

Comparison of Keno Strategies

Strategy Pros Cons
Choosing Fewer Numbers (1-4) Higher odds of winning small payouts Lower potential payouts
Choosing More Numbers (10-20) Potential for larger payouts Significantly lower odds of winning
Hot Numbers Strategy Based on trends, possibly higher success No statistical backing; relies on luck
Random Number Selection Easy and quick; no analysis required Similar odds to strategic selections
